- Lead installation/deployments of BG technology on customer sites from installation to System Engineering hand-off
- Ensure compliance to building and safety codes by all federal, state, and/or local regulations
- Manage installation contractors and work to resolve deployment issues
- Manage BG engineers while on site that are tasked with installation efforts
- Manage customer relationship on-site and coordinate site level tasks with local building management
- Work cross-functionally with internal stakeholders to meet installation criteria
- Drive feedback and improvement efforts from site to System Engineering teams
- Provide support to the active project to drive progress and prevent or mitigate stoppages or downtime
- Responsible for tracking and achieving project operational and budgetary metrics
- Develop standardization processes and technical solutions to drive down installation time and cost
- Oversee customer training and handoff tasks to guarantee a smooth integration of BG’s technology in existing operations
